Hi! I just had the same problem and actually called the service number that came with the rocket blender. The lady on the phone said that the plastic cup must have expanded (from heat), and to stick it in the refrigerator for 24 hours until the plastic shrinks back down to normal. After the 24 hours the cup should be able to come off. Kind of makes sense, but I hope it works!
This has happened to me twice in two months. Both times it was my fault because I left it running for too long and the motor got too hot. Just leave it to cool off for 10-15 mins and you should be able to get the cup out. Putting in the fridge for 24 hrs seems EXTREME. Just have to let the motor cool down. I thought it had to be running to remove also, but this last time, I was able to unscrew it without it running. Don't let it run for more than 2 mins at a time and it probably won't happen.
